Preview
Juventus and Roma meet at Juventus Stadium, in a match for this stage of the Coppa Italia (Quarter‑finals). The head‑to‑head history at this stadium, favours the home team, since in the last 4 head‑to‑heads they won 4. Accordingly, in the last head‑to‑head played at this stadium, for the Serie A, on 22‑12‑2018, Juventus won by (1‑0). M. Mandžukić (35' ) and Douglas Costa (90' ) scored the goals of the match for Juventus. Roma registers significant differences between home and away results, so special attention is due to the home/away factor.

Analysis Juventus

The home team comes to this stage of the Coppa Italia (Quarter‑finals) after having eliminated Udinese with a home win by (4‑0) in the previous round. This is a team that usually maintains its competitive levels in home and away matches, since in the last 30 matches they register 10 wins, 3 draws and 2 losses in away matches; against 13 wins, 1 draw and 1 loss at their stadium. In their last match, for the Serie A, they got a home win against Parma by (2‑1). In the last 10 home matches Juventus has won 8, tied 1 and lost 1. They haven't been very strong defensively, since they have suffered goals in 7 of the last 10 matches, but their offense has scored frequently, since they have scored goals in all of the last 10 matches. They have been able to score first and have done so in 13 of the last 15 matches, they have reached half‑time in advantage in 6 of those 13 matches and have held on to the lead until the end of the 90' in 11 of them.

Juventus heads into this game with a 2-1 victory against Parma, adding the fourth consecutive victory in official matches: Cristiano Ronaldo was the great hero when he scored the two goals of the team. In the last game to count for the Italian Cup, the home club won Udinese by 4-0. In this match against Roma, coach Maurizio Sarri should attack since the first minutes, also taking advantage of the opponent's weaknesses. Cristiano Ronaldo is one of the most dangerous players in the attack, this being Juventus' top scorer with 18 goals scored. Out of this game due to injury are Khedira, Demiral and Chiellini.

Confirmed Lineup: Gianluigi Buffon, Danilo, Daniele Rugani, Alex Sandro, Leonardo Bonucci, Rodrigo Bentancur, Douglas Costa, Adrien Rabiot, Miralem Pjanić, Cristiano Ronaldo, Gonzalo Higuaín.

Analysis Roma

The away team comes to this stage of the Coppa Italia (Quarter‑finals) after a away win by (0‑2) against Parma. This is a team that usually gets better results in away matches than at home, since in the last 30 matches they register 9 wins, 4 draws and 2 losses in away matches, with 28 goals scored and 11 conceded; against 6 wins, 6 draws and 3 losses at their stadium, with 30 goals scored and 22 conceded. In their last match, for the Serie A, they got an away win against Genoa by (1‑3). In the last 10 away matches Roma has won 6, tied 2 and lost 2. Defensive consistency hasn’t been their best feature, as they have conceded goals in 7 of the last 10 matches, but their offense has scored consistently, as they have scored goals in 8 of the last 10 matches. In 15 matches, they have conceded the first goal 5 times and have only turned the score around in 1.

Roma start this game with a victory, by 1-3, in the trip to Genoa, adding this way the second triumph followed in official matches: the goals of the team were signed by Dzeko, Under and Davide Biraschi (own goal). One of those victories was for the Italian Cup, when Roma beat Parma by 0-2. In this match against Juventus, coach Paulo Fonseca should play in the usual 4-3-3 with Kluivert, Under and Dzeko being the offensive references of the visiting team. The last player mentioned above is the best scorer of this team with 11 goals scored. Out of this game due to physical problems are Zappacosta, Zaniolo and Pastore.

Confirmed Lineup: Pau López, Gianluca Mancini, Alessandro Florenzi, Chris Smalling, Aleksandar Kolarov, Amadou Diawara, Lorenzo Pellegrini, Bryan Cristante, Cengiz Ünder, Nikola Kalinić, Justin Kluivert.
Coach: P. Rodrigues Fonseca.
